    From wikipedia
    6.1 Hemi Applications:
    The Hemi is also available in a 6,059 cc (6.059 L; 369.7 cu in) version.[8] The engine's bore is 4.055 in (103 mm), and many other changes were made to allow it to produce 425 horsepower (317 kW) at 6200 rpm and 420 lb·ft (569 N·m) at 4800 rpm.
    2005-2010 Chrysler 300C SRT-8
    2005-2008 Dodge Magnum SRT-8
    2006-2010 Dodge Charger SRT-8
    2006-2010 Jeep Grand Cherokee SRT-8
    2008-2010 Dodge Challenger SRT-8
